Post of some potentially good job skills to possess:
Required Skills
• PHP 5.x (2-5 years experience in real world programming environment)
• CSS, HTML, Javascript
• MySQL 5.x (1-5 years experience in real world programming environment)
• Object-Oriented Design & Development
• Basic Apache knowledge
• Linux knowledge (must be able to configure programming environment)
• Practical problem solving and troubleshooting skills
Prefered Skills :
• Apache Administration, Linux, IIS, Windows Server 2003
• Graphic Design, Flash
• Photoshop
